#e14ca8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e14ca8 is composed of 88.2% red, 29.8%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 323 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 59%. #e14ca8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#c30051.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#e14ca8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e14ca8 has RGB values of R:225, G:76,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.25,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14765224.

Shades and Tints of #e14ca8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060104 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e14ca8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999497 is the less saturated color, while #f934ae is the most saturated one.
